Output 816431b8396b8c4579d8eea66153bd8b013a960a2ed4050dd4b517903ad33f37:25

value
131462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ec169d5ac840479ce14e23932f55b6bc9fa5f1 OP_EQUAL
address
323kmpn9jArVRXu7AA4wDcpxa4K6bEhZNq
transaction
816431b8396b8c4579d8eea66153bd8b013a960a2ed4050dd4b517903ad33f37
spent
true